What are the key differences between TurboTax versions for cryptocurrency tax reporting?
Can you explain the main differences between the various versions of TurboTax when it comes to reporting cryptocurrency taxes? I'm trying to understand which version would be the best fit for my needs.
3 answers
- Mays BauerJul 12, 2022 · 4 years agoSure! The key differences between the TurboTax versions for cryptocurrency tax reporting lie in the features and the level of support they offer. The basic version is suitable for individuals with simple cryptocurrency transactions, while the higher-tier versions provide more advanced features like importing transaction data from exchanges and wallets, calculating gains and losses, and generating tax forms specifically for cryptocurrency. It's important to assess your needs and the complexity of your transactions to choose the right version.
